Did a lot of Reddit research & found out that Subaru offers better tweeters that fit this year Outback (mostly). They’re Kicker brand and the magnets are easily 10x the size of the stock tweeters. Genuine Subaru H631SFJ101 Tweeter... https://www.amazon.com/dp/B00PV6F8I2?ref=ppx_pop_mob_ap_share Those popped right in with a small s shaped screwdriver. Took 30 min to swap. Since those were already Kicker i opted to keep them all in the same family (not that you have to). I put these 6x9s in the front: https://www.crutchfield.com/p_20647KSC69/Kicker-47KSC6904.html And these 6 3/4s in the rear doors: https://www.crutchfield.com/p_20647KSC67/Kicker-47KSC6704.html Went the extra mile and used dynamat inside the doors (behind the speakers) & ripped off the plastic moisture guards to cover the entire doors. The door speakers were about $300. The tweeters were $100. Dynamat wasn’t necessary but dramatically decreased road noise and there’s absolutely no rattle. Unless we put something in the door pockets. Crutchfield included the necessary harnesses and adapters. Everything was plug n play. I’ve not installed an amp because it’s already so loud. I don’t really turn it up past 20. You’re already rocking pretty hard at that volume. Everyone that rides with me asks if I have subs but I don’t. They’re not that hard to swap out. I watched a couple YouTube videos and did it myself. The tweeters were $100 and took 20 minutes to change in the dash. Doors weren’t as easy but were not difficult. 6x9s in the front & 6 3/4s in the back ran me about $300 on Crutchfield. Took a couple hours to install because I covered the doors in Dynamat. Sounds a million times better and I haven’t even added an amp yet. But it’s still just a 6 speaker setup with no sub. I’d have preferred to have the HK system & not had to do this myself, but when everything else about the vehicle is exactly what we wanted it was a fair compromise. Totally understand that. I emailed my dealership first and had them confirm in writing that swapping the speakers would not void my warranties. Their response was pretty much, “if you just swap the speakers for compatible ones that don’t require any additional or alternative wiring that’s not a violation of your warranty.” That’s why I’ve not added an amp. I’m still too worried about swapping harnesses and potentially voiding our warranty.
